The Real Estate Commissioner in California is:
AElected by California voters
BAppointed by the GovernorCorrect
CAppointed by the State Legislature
DElected by the California Association of Realtors
Why Appointed by the Governor Is Correct
Answer B: Appointed by the Governor
The Real Estate Commissioner is appointed by the Governor of California and serves as the head of the Department of Real Estate.
